HUNGARY: Privatization Scandal Threatens Coalition

Revelations that Hungary’s privatization agency paid $5.1 million to an outside consultant have led to the country’s biggest political scandal yet. The illegal payment fiasco – in which state money was most likely destined for party election funds – shook trust in the government and heightened suspicions that corruption is rife throughout state agencies, jeopardizing the governing coalition’s success in the 1998 elections
